{Source: MMS students & alumni}Based on the reviews and feedback from current students and alumni, here's a summary of the key points:* Placements: 100% placements every year, with the highest package being INR20 Lac per annum, and the average package ranging between INR5-6 Lac per annum.* Course Curriculum: Designed to prepare students for corporate challenges, with a focus on practical applications and theoretical foundations. Faculty members are dedicated and knowledgeable, providing excellent guidance and mentorship.* Infrastructure: Well-maintained classrooms, libraries, and laboratory facilities, with Wi-Fi connectivity across the campus. Canteen and sports facilities are also available.* Teaching Quality: Experienced faculty members provide excellent teaching, with a strong emphasis on hands-on learning and practical exposure.* Internships: Compulsory internship programme in the final year, offering students valuable industry experience and exposure to real-world projects.* Campus Environment: Good atmosphere, with plenty of opportunities for extracurricular activities and socializing.In conclusion, MMS at JBIMS Mumbai appears to offer excellent placements, a rigorous yet effective course curriculum, and a conducive learning environment. While there may be some limitations in terms of infrastructure (due to age), the overall experience seems to justify the investment for those seeking a career in finance.

No, Jamnalal Bajaj Institute of Management Studies (JBIMS), Mumbai does not accept MAT scores for admission to the MMS programme. The accepted entrance exams for JBIMS admission include MAH CET, CAT, and CMAT. JBIMS primarily accepts scores from exams like CAT (Common Admission Test) conducted by IIMs.

Admission to the Master of Management Studies (MMS), MMS in Financial Management, MMS in Marketing Management, and Master of Human Resource Development (MHRD) through MAH CET MBA is available at the Jamnalal Bajaj Institute of Management Studies. The MAH CET CAP Round 1 and Round 2 minimal cutoff, according to the JBIMS cutoff 2023 for MMS, was 99.99 percentile. According to an analysis of Master of Management Studies (MMS) cutoffs from prior years, JBIMS has shown a better tendency in comparison to 2022. Also, there is an improving trend in this area when comparing 2022 to 2021. In 2021 and 2022, the Master of Management Studies (MMS) cutoff scores were 99.96 and 99.98, respectively.

If you missed filling out the form for JBIMS through CMAT, you can still apply for direct admission after your results. The process for direct admission involves being shortlisted based on your profile and CAT/MH-CET scores. Shortlisted candidates are then called for an in-person assessment, which includes a Group Activity, a Personal Interview, and a Written Ability Test. The final selection is based on the total score in the entrance test, Personal Interview, WAT, and Group Activity. The Written Test consists of 100 questions with 1 mark each, and there is a 0.25 negative marking for wrong answers in certain sections. General category students need to score 50 marks in the written test, while reserved category students have their own score requirements
